"Fire in the hole" nghĩa là gì?
Photo by Yosh Ginsu on Unsplash
"Fire in the hole" có fire là nổ súng, bắn súng, hỏa lực -> cụm từ này nghĩa là câu lệnh thông báo kích nổ, khai hỏa, thường trong không gian hạn chế.
Ví dụ
Four milk jugs (bình) filled with gasoline were wrapped in detonation cord (dây kích nổ) outside a Las Vegas Fire Department training center on Wednesday. Bomb squad technician Mark Duncan yelled, “Fire in the hole!” three times.
Colorful string-like (có hình dáng giống sợi dây) tubes covered Ueland Tree Farm's new football-field-sized rock quarry (mỏ đá) Wednesday. Attached to explosive powder drilled into a massive chunk of basalt, the tubing led to a detonator (bộ kích nổ) in the hands of Tim Fredericks, an explosives engineer. "Fire in the hole!" yelled Fredericks of Chehalis-based McCallum Rock Drilling. "There she goes!"
“And suddenly I heard a scream say ‘fire in the hole!’” he said. "And suddenly the big explosion. I saw the sun coming to me, my family was screaming." Some 28 homes were damaged or destroyed in the blast June 30, 2021.
The same is true for explosion welding, though it’s entirely unlike any traditional (truyền thống) hand welding methods you’ve ever seen before. Today, we’ll explore how this technique works and the applications it’s useful for. Fire in the hole!
